Our coaching model empowers people with attention-deficit/hyperactivity disorder (ADHD) so that they can better manage their lives and reach their goals. We are trained professionals who create customized programs and provide regular support in order to help our clients develop both skills and action plans that improve their daily lives. ADHD coaching may be effective for people with no diagnosis, but who have a desire to become more organized and efficient. It may also be useful for people with a variety of mental health conditions.
Our Speech therapy services are needed by people who have have trouble with talking, listening or reading, or impairments in clarity of thinking or memory. Speech therapy also benefits those experiencing hoarse voice, troubles swallowing, or certain functional breathing conditions, like paradoxical vocal cord dysfunction. Often these problems start because of an injury, a stroke, an infection, a tumor, surgery, or a progressive disorder. Speech therapy is short-term and aimed at helping clients overcome or adjust to relatively new diagnoses.
David White is a skilled speech pathologist and coach helping adults with cognitive and communication complaints. He became aware that his understanding of how the brain works and the techniques of rehabilitation therapy can help people with ADHD and other executive function troubles. He started Montview to meet clients where they are. His clients say that he listens, makes them feel safe and heard. He encourages and challenges them to new successes. He offers practical and insightful interventions to enable clients to improve their lives.
David has been a speech pathologist for 24 years. He obtained his master's degree in Communication Sciences and Disorders from The Ohio State University and was a National Institute of Health Trainee. He practices in hospital ICUs, outpatient clinics, and home health. He has experience in healthcare leadership. He has published research on how we use melody and intonation of speech to understand the meaning of words in context and on how intubation for respiratory failure affects swallowing.
